This is a NIH grant project focusing on malaria prevention strategies post-flooding in Uganda, with a total award of $531,975, starting September 2025 and ending August 2028. The project involves multiple research aims including intervention effectiveness, vector population analysis, and cost-effectiveness evaluation.
